Ovid (43 BC–AD 17 or 18), whose full name was Publius Ovidius Naso, was a Roman poet. He was born in Sulmona in central Italy and died in exile in Tomis on the Black Sea. His best-known works include *The Art of Love* and *Metamorphoses*. His cognomen “Naso” referred to his prominent nose.
